ST MICHAELS ALL ANGELS CHURCH
miles
121
Ravenscroft Road
Beckenham, Greater London
BR3 4TN
VENUE TIMETABLE
Tuesdays
Saturdays
ALSO NEARBY....
It Takes A Village, Crystal Palace
St Hugh's Community Centre
0 months - 12 months
0.7 miles Book now